Phoenix, AZ – By the end of 2019, all Embraer Phenom 100 aircraft delivered in 2008 are required to comply with a 120-month airframe inspection. Currently there are numerous operators still in need of this required inspection.

Executive Aircraft Maintenance (EAM), based in Phoenix, Arizona, is offering a 120-month inspection and landing gear overhaul package to help Phenom owners reduce downtime and improve cost savings on this required maintenance.

The 120-month inspection includes all required inspection items in addition to engine inspections and R&I of the landing gear. The required landing gear overhaul includes complete disassembly, inspection, repairs, NDT, reassembly, functional testing, painting, and return to service.
